Comparison review

The Samsung Omnia II is a bit better than the Galaxy Prevail 2, with a overall score of 53.4 against 49.3. The Samsung Omnia II has Windows Mobile Professional 6.5 operating system, while Galaxy Prevail 2 works with Android 4.1 operating system. Samsung Omnia II's design is a little bit lighter and a little thinner than Galaxy Prevail 2.

Galaxy Prevail 2 features a bit better hardware performance than Samsung Omnia II. They have a Single-Core processor. The Galaxy Prevail 2 features a bit better display than Samsung Omnia II, because although it has a quite worse display pixel density, and they both have the same exact 800 x 480px resolution, the Galaxy Prevail 2 also counts with a bit larger display.

The Samsung Omnia II counts with much more memory for applications, games, photos and videos than Samsung Galaxy Prevail 2, although it has no external memory slot. The Galaxy Prevail 2 features a bit longer battery performance than Samsung Omnia II, because it has 1750mAh of battery capacity instead of 1500mAh.

The Samsung Omnia II shoots slightly better photos and videos than Samsung Galaxy Prevail 2. They have a same resolution camera in the back.
